Neo Malthusian are those who criticize Malthus insistence on the moral restraints as the preventive check to population growth but accepting and supporting many of his argument. Neo Malthusian term was first used in 1877 by Dr Samwel Van Houten who were the vice president of the Malthusian league.

WebDec 20, 2016 · The Malthusian economy was the economic system that characterized almost all economies before the industrial revolution. In this regime fertility and mortality rates at different material income levels determined the average real income level and life expectancy at birth.
